Abstract
The utility model discloses a spring bolt subassembly of mortise lock, including casing, oblique tongue, be equipped with in the casing and drive the assembly of stirring of oblique tongue toward the casing internal slip, its characterized in that the casing in still be equipped with the insurance subassembly that can withstand the oblique tongue when locking a door state, the insurance subassembly including: one end of the swinging piece is movably connected to the shell, and the other end of the swinging piece is provided with a support arm; the sliding block can be driven by the latch bolt to slide into the shell, a pin with one end extending out of the shell is connected to the sliding block, and a spring which can drive the support arm of the swinging piece to swing downwards to prop against the latch bolt when the pin is compressed is connected between the other end of the pin and the swinging piece; the poking component comprises a linkage sheet which can jack up the support arm when unlocking. The utility model has the advantages of compact structure, convenient installation and good anti-theft performance.

[background technology]
The theftproof performance of conventional ferrule lock is relatively good, but the structure more complicated installs also cumbersome; And, often all do not have insurance function for the lock pin lock that has only an oblique tongue.Traditional single tongue lock pin lock has only an oblique tongue, tiltedly be provided with back-moving spring on the tongue, at closing time tiltedly tongue can in lock body, withdraw automatically, the tongue that retreads of closing the door stretches out lock body again automatically and realizes locking a door under the effect of back-moving spring, this structure has illustrated as long as give suitable power of oblique tongue, just oblique tongue can be headed in the lock body, modal theft case is exactly, criminal utilizes iron plate and so on that the tablet of certain degree of hardness is arranged when theft, insert in the crack between a door and its frame, slowly stir oblique tongue, behind oblique tongue withdrawal lock body, just door can be opened, its theftproof performance is poor.The utility model is developed under a kind of like this background technology.

[specific embodiment]
Below in conjunction with the accompanying drawing and the specific embodiment the utility model is described in further detail:
As Fig. 1 to Fig. 3 and shown in Figure 9, a kind of dead bolt assembly of lock pin lock, include the housing of forming by loam cake 11, lower cover 12 and panel 13 1, be provided with the oblique tongue of forming by oblique tongue 21 and oblique tongue neck 22 2 in the housing 1, riveted joint has an installed part 5 between loam cake 11 and the lower cover 12, installed part 5 both sides are provided with chute 501, and chute 501 tops are provided with two jacks 502; Oblique tongue neck 22 1 ends are provided with two legs, 221, two legs 221 and are bearing on the chute 501, and can horizontally slip along chute 501; At installed part 5 and tiltedly be provided with between the tongue 21 and can withstand oblique tongue 21 when closing the door state and prevent Arming Assembly 7 in its withdrawal housing 1.
To shown in Figure 6, Arming Assembly 7 includes with reference to figure 1, Fig. 4:
One slide block 71 places on the oblique tongue neck 22 movably, and the one end is provided with the support portion 710 that raises up, and the other end is provided with the baffle plate 711 that raises up, and baffle plate 711 is provided with mounting groove 7110;
One pin 72, pin 72 1 ends are provided with the breach 720 of annular, and annular breach 720 is buckled in the mounting groove 7110 on the slide block 71, and slide block 71 and pin 72 are connected as a single entity; Outside the extended housing 1 of pin 72 other ends.
One swing component 73, one end are provided with two pins, 733, two pins 733 and insert swingably in two jacks 502 on the installed part 5; Be provided with the support chip 735 that is upturned between two pins 733; Swing component 73 other ends are provided with bending part 732, two support arms 731 that are equipped with on two support arms, 731, two support arms 731 to lower convexity and can be supported on by bending part 732 on the oblique tongue neck 22, are provided with the cover piece 734 that is upturned between two support arms 731;
One spring 74, one end are socketed on the pin 72, and the other end is socketed on the cover piece 734 of swing component 73.
Also be provided with shifting component 9 in the housing 1, shifting component 9 includes two double-action plates 6, double-action plate 6 one ends are provided with the buckle 601 of bending, buckle 601 buckles in the breach 220 of oblique tongue neck 22 both is connected as a single entity, the height of buckle 601 makes it expose a part outside breach 220 greater than the thickness of oblique tongue neck 22; Also be provided with on the double-action plate 6 and drive mouthful 602, two shifting blocks 3 and all snap in to drive in mouthfuls 602 and flexibly connect with double-action plate 6 by being fan-shaped drive division 301 on it.
In the utility model, tiltedly also be provided with the back-moving spring 4 that oblique tongue 2 is resetted between tongue 21 and the installed part 5.
Operating principle of the present utility model is: with reference to figure 9, shown in Figure 10, under the state that door is opened, back-moving spring 4 and spring 74 all are in normal condition, tiltedly tongue 21 and pin 72 all stretch out in outside the panel 13, at this moment, the support portion 710 of slide block 71 just withstands on the below of the bending part 732 of swing component 73, makes two support arms, 731 left ends be higher than oblique tongue 21, prevents that it from withstanding oblique tongue 21.When locking a door, tiltedly tongue 21 is headed in the housing 1 gradually, the support portion 710 of slide block 71 slips over bending part 732 gradually, in this process, tiltedly tongue 2 drive slide blocks 71 move right together with pin 72, pin 72 forces spring 74 compressions, owing to be provided with the support chip 735 that is upturned between two pins 733 of swing component, support chip 735 contacts with installed part 5 and forms stress point, make spring 74 active force down, two pins 733 because of swing component 73 are in two jacks 502 that are inserted in swingably on the installed part 5 simultaneously, when oblique tongue 21 stretches out the lockhole that enters outside the housing 1 on the door pillar, two support arms 731 of swing component 73 left ends withstand the right-hand member (as shown in figure 11) of oblique tongue 21 toward the bottoms, realize the locked function of oblique tongue 2; After normally unblanking with key, driving shifting block 3 by handle rotates, the fan-shaped drive division 301 of shifting block 3 orders about double-action plate 6 toward moving right, double-action plate 6 drives oblique tongue 2 again toward moving right, because the height of the buckle 601 on the double-action plate 6 is greater than the thickness of oblique tongue neck 22, so buckle 601 stretches out bending part 731 jack-up of the part of oblique tongue neck 22 with swing component 73, two support arms 731 on the swing component 73 leave oblique tongue 21, releasing realizes the function of opening the door to its locking.
